I believe its using the same RPC over HTTP method that OWA uses to talk
to the exchange server, and that it's not "screen scraping" OWA.  So I
think technically it doesn't support MAPI but it does connect using the
same method Microsoft recommends users to connect remotely to Exchange
(RPC over HTTP+SSL) and speaks with exchange in its native language.  I
think this is why it depends on libsoup (SOAP).

Anyway, I'd try to go further to answer your question, but I'm not sure
what you're getting at.  What exactly do you want to do that you're not
sure it does?  If it's speed you're concerned about, I wouldn't worry.
It's faster than the web interface in my experience.
